Descrição do cargo:

DESCRIPTION: 

The Executive Assistant & Studio Team Coordinator provides support and assistance to the GM of Studio SEA and Head of Operations APAC across administrative, operational and organizational areas. This role will be responsible for all secretarial and administrative support, including communications and coordination with senior APAC GM leaders in the region and other internal stakeholders across SEA, as well as external parties. The candidate must enjoy a fast-paced, dynamic environment, be adept at documentation and planning, and be able to collaborate with a vast number of cross-functional teams across different stakeholders.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Provide full secretarial and administrative support to the GM of Studio SEA, and Head of Operations APAC
  • Manage day-to-day calendar, including scheduling, coordinate department calendar; department meetings and events
  • Coordinate and act as the point of contact for local and overseas meetings and conference arrangements
  • Work with Casual Buyer Team to process purchase orders and invoice in SAP
  • Support all Studio team administration needs
  • Support administration and coordination of department initiatives and events
  • Provide logistics support for meeting arrangement
  • Distribute department information, materials and presentations, as required
  • Maintain efficient document filing systems (manually or electronically as applied)
  • Manage travel arrangements including booking of flights, ticketing, hotel reservation, visa application, airport/hotel transfer, etc.
  • Prepare and submit Travel and Entertainment (T&E) claims using the internal tracking system
  • Attend and take minutes of meetings both in the office and at other locations, as required
  • Liaise with SEA Studio and Marketing leaders and teams to ensure follow up and that deadlines are met
  • Assist in coordinating important pieces of work/projects for the GM between her team and others in the organization as required
  • Other office duties and personal matters as and when assigned by the GM

Sobre The Walt Disney Company:

A The Walt Disney Company, juntamente com suas subsidiárias e afiliadas, é uma líder diversificada em entretenimento familiar e mídia internacional que inclui três segmentos principais de negócios: Disney Entertainment, ESPN e Disney Experiences. Desde seus primeiros passos como um estúdio de desenho animado na década de 1920 até se tornar o atual nome de destaque na indústria do entretenimento, a Disney orgulhosamente dá continuidade a seu legado de criação de histórias e experiências de padrão internacional para toda a família. As histórias, personagens e experiências da Disney tocam consumidores e visitantes de todas as partes do mundo. Com operações em mais de 40 países, nossos funcionários e colaboradores trabalham juntos para criar experiências de entretenimento adoradas por todos.
